Recently when opening a booster pack, I found a Hardened Scales. It's an enchantment and a rare, but I am confused on its ability.
It reads:
If one or more +1/+1 counters would be placed on a creature you control, that many plus one +1/+1 counters are to be placed on it instead.
Could someone explain what this means and when to use it?
Thanks
{Hardened Scales} lets say you use the Outlast ability of {Disowned Ancestor}, it would get a +1/+1 counter from outlast and an extra +1/+1 counter because of Hardened Scales. If you had a card that gave your creature 3 +1/+1 counters, it would get 3 counters, plus the one extra from Hardened Scales
